JAMDAT Mobile

JAMDAT Mobile, Inc., is an United States of American video game production company. Their primary business is producing games for mobile phones. They have also produced other entertainment-related software such as ringtone applications, as well as games for other platforms such as personal digital assistants and personal computers. JAMDAT produces games in a wide variety of genres, such as fighting games, puzzle games, and sports titles. Their most well-known products to date include their series of bowling games (JAMDAT Bowling and JAMDAT Bowling 2), a mobile conversion of the widely-known PC puzzle game Bejeweled, a conversion for Pocket PC of the PC game Worms World Party and their NFL, NBA, and MLB -branded games. They have relationships with all major North American wireless service carriers, such as Sprint Corporation, Verizon, and Cingular, as well as many minor North American and some major European and Asian carriers. They have offices in Los Angeles, Montreal, London, Tokyo, Hyderabad, India, and Honolulu.

As a production company in the wireless video game industry, JAMDAT s primary service is linking game developers, who generally develop the games from idea to playable Software, with wireless telecommunications service providers or carriers , who sell the games to their customers. To this end, they maintain strong relationships with major companies in both groups. They also do the majority of the work regarding quality assurance for their games, and are heavily involved in the advertising process as well.

JAMDAT Mobile was founded by Scott Lahman and Zack Norman, two ex-Activision executives, in March of 2000. They were joined in November of that year by Mitch Lasky, who had also worked at Activision, and is currently the Chief Executive Officer of JAMDAT. Since then, the company has grown at a rapid rate. JAMDAT initial public offering in late 2004, and is traded on the NASDAQ stock exchange under the symbol JMDT.
